Best easy hiking trails around Timberwood Park

  • The most popular easy hiking route is Bush Hill Viewpoint – Eisenhower Park loop from Eisenhower Park, a 2.4 miles (3.9 km) trail that takes 1 hour 4 minutes to complete. This route offers panoramic views of the surrounding hill country from an observation tower.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is Cibolo Canyons Trail, an easy 3.3 miles (5.4 km) path. This trail provides a pleasant walk through natural landscapes with minimal elevation gain.
  • Local hikers also love the Cedar Flats and Hillview Nature Trail Loop, a 2.3 miles (3.6 km) trail leading through varied natural terrain, often completed in about 58 minutes.

Dwight D. Eisenhower Park is a 420-acre park with great hill country landscapes. It features 6 miles of trails, an observation tower, and BBQ and picnic facilities. Pets are allowed on leash, and hikers are encouraged to stay on designated trails and not disturb the natural environment.

What are some notable viewpoints or attractions along easy trails?

One significant attraction is Eisenhower Park, which features an observation tower accessible via a 0.4-mile trail. This tower provides panoramic 360-degree views of the surrounding hill country and the San Antonio skyline. You can also find the Bush Hill Viewpoint and the Soaring Bird Over Open Sky highlight in the area.

What is the typical length and duration of easy hikes in this area?

Easy hikes in Timberwood Park vary in length, but many are designed for shorter outings. For instance, the Cedar Flats and Hillview Nature Trail Loop is 2.3 miles (3.6 km) and takes about 58 minutes, while the Bush Hill Loop via Hillview Nature Trail is 1.6 miles (2.6 km) and takes around 42 minutes.

What is the best time of year for easy hiking in Timberwood Park?

The Texas Hill Country generally offers pleasant hiking conditions during the cooler months, from fall through spring (October to April). Summers can be very hot, so early mornings or late afternoons are recommended if hiking during that season.
